Einzelnen Beitrag anzeigen

Curby

Registriert seit: 29. Sep 2003
17 Beiträge
 
#1

Bitte helfen bei Erläuterung des Algorithmus

  Alt 23. Okt 2003, 17:14
Erläutern Sie den folgenden Verschlüsselungsalgorithmus!

Delphi-Quellcode:

procedure TKryptobox.Verschluesseln;
(* -------------------------------------------------------------- *) 
var
  i : integer;

  begin
  Geheimtext := '' ;
  Vorbehandeln(Klartext);
  i := 1;
  while i <= length(klartext) do
  begin
    geheimtext := geheimtext + klartext[i];
    i := i + 3;
  end;
  i := 2;
  while i <= length(klartext) do
  begin
    geheimtext := geheimtext + klartext[i];
    i := i + 3;
  end;
  i := 3;
  while i <= length(klartext) do
  begin
    geheimtext := geheimtext + klartext[i];
    i := i + 3;
  end;
end;
Optimieren Sie den Algorithmus durch Einführung einer weiteren Schleife!
  Mit Zitat antworten Zitat